HUBBARD, Ohio - A portion of Interstate 80 is closed due to a tractor trailer accident.
A semi-truck carrying propane, ethanol and other petroleum products hit a bridge about one mile west of 62, causing it to explode. Crews used airpacks to extinguish the fire, since ethanol cannot be extinguished with water or foam.
The back trailer of the vehicle fell over the bridge.
ODOT, Haz-Mat and the EPA are on scene.
The Conway Freight truck was headed from Clearfield, Pennsylvania to Lordstown, Ohio.
The driver of the truck was taken to St. Elizabeth's hospital, where he is listed in stable condition and was not burned.
No other cars were involved in the crash.
Traffic in the west bound lane will exit at 62 in Hubbard.
